What advantages over a pump up hydraulic press apart from speed?

 

None, the fly press is primarily a production line machine where the hydraulic press tends be much slower and thus not so good when you have thousands of units to make.

 

Modern press work can beat the old school but needs a significant investment in machine and tooling so works best on the highest volume work.
